mysql替换某个字段的某个字符串 mysql替换字符传

导读:在MySQL中 , 替换字符串是一项常见的操作 。无论是在数据清洗、数据处理还是数据分析等领域,都需要用到替换字符串的技巧 。本文将介绍MySQL中替换字符串的方法和技巧,帮助读者更好地掌握这一重要技能 。
【mysql替换某个字段的某个字符串 mysql替换字符传】1. 使用REPLACE函数进行简单替换
MySQL中提供了REPLACE函数 , 可以快速进行简单的字符替换 。其使用方法如下:
```
REPLACE(str, old_str, new_str)
其中,str表示要替换的字符串,old_str表示要被替换的子字符串,new_str表示用来替换old_str的新字符串 。
2. 使用REGEXP_REPLACE函数进行正则表达式替换
如果需要进行更加复杂的替换操作,可以使用REGEXP_REPLACE函数 。该函数支持正则表达式,可以实现更加灵活的替换操作 。其使用方法如下:
REGEXP_REPLACE(str, pattern, replace_str)
其中 , str表示要替换的字符串,pattern表示要匹配的正则表达式,replace_str表示用来替换匹配结果的新字符串 。
3. 使用SUBSTRING函数进行截取和替换
除了REPLACE和REGEXP_REPLACE函数,还可以使用SUBSTRING函数进行截取和替换 。该函数可以从一个字符串中截取出指定位置的子串 , 并用新的字符串替换原有的子串 。其使用方法如下:
SUBSTRING(str, pos, len, new_str)
其中,str表示要替换的字符串,pos表示要截取的子串的起始位置,len表示要截取的子串的长度 , new_str表示用来替换原有子串的新字符串 。
总结:MySQL中提供了多种方法进行字符串替换,包括REPLACE、REGEXP_REPLACE和SUBSTRING函数 。这些函数可以满足不同场景下的替换需求 , 帮助用户更加高效地进行数据处理和分析 。

    推荐阅读